Understanding High Blood Sugar

High blood sugar, or hyperglycemia is a condition characterized by elevated levels of glucose in the bloodstream. This imbalance can lead to various health complications, including diabetes. Conventional treatments often involve medications and lifestyle changes, but an increasing number of people are turning to alternative therapies such as homeopathy.

What is Homeopathy?

Homeopathy is a holistic system of medicine that originated in the late 18th century. Based on the principle of "like cures like," homeopathy involves using highly diluted substances to stimulate the body's natural healing processes. Practitioners of homeopathy believe that treating the root cause of an ailment, rather than just its symptoms, is crucial for long-term health.
